Position Description & Summary Statement

The President & CEO shall be the principal executive officer of the Museum & Library, including both the Chicago and Somers campuses, and shall provide, under direction of the Board of Directors, general supervision and control of the business and affairs of the Museum & Library.

The President & CEO will collaborate with the Founder of the PMML and COO of Philanthropic Activities on programs and other initiatives designed to further the mission of the PMML.

Essential Position Qualifications

  • Successful senior executive with 10+ years’ experience in non-profit operations and fundraising; museum and/or library services preferred. Individual with significant experience in for-profit business, academia or high level professional practice such as law or accounting will also be considered.
  • Master’s Degree or higher required; Military education at the level of Command and General Staff College or War College will also be favorably considered.
  • In depth knowledge, personal interest, and experience with military history and/or military affairs. Direct military experience a plus.
  • Energetic self-starter with the ability to exercise appropriate discretion, a high level of professionalism and excellent personal reputation.
  • Willing and able to promote and develop the PMML and maintain the highest standards of intellectual integrity.
  • Personable, articulate, dependable, organized, and attentive to detail.
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ills; able to communicate effectively and establish rapport with a wide variety of people including but not limited to the Founder, board members, staff, members, supporters, donors, vendors and colleagues.
  • Demonstrated leadership qualities and experience in managing and developing professional staff.
  • Demonstrated public speaking skills
  • Willingness to travel as required/requested
  • Demonstrated ability to build and maintain partnerships and relationships with a diverse array of organizations and individuals.
  • Financially literate and highly sensitive and cognizant of ratios and amounts needed for operational sustainment, growth and development as well as ability to do realistic financial projections at the non CPA level.

Assigned Responsibilities & Duties

FUNDRAISING:

  • Work with the Director of Development and development staff to lead the annual fundraising planning process and develop effective strategies to achieve income targets;
  • Increase overall growth by 20% annually through donor base expansion and additional giving opportunities;
  • Achieve public operating charity status in line with the strategic plan and organizational goals;
  • Identify new potential income sources and produce strategies to access these funds;
  • Lead an Individual Giving Development Plan which includes recruitment and development of new donors, as well as major gifts and planned giving programs.
  • Lead all activity related to the planning and execution of the annual Liberty Gala;
  • Work with the Director of Development and designated consultants to raise funds for the PMAC and Cold War Memorial in Somers, WI.
  • Work with the Director of Development toward the growth of the membership program.

PROGRAMMING:

  • Work with the Director of Programs and Outreach to develop and execute content strategy in such areas such as public television programs, Liberty Gala operations and to meet vendor obligations;
  • Work with appropriate staff to develop educational programs for K-12 students and family-oriented programming;
  • Serve as executive producer of PMML programs and executive editor of PMML publications;
  • As directed, serve as a board member or committee member of key partner organizations;
  • Work with the Director of Library Services and the Director of Museum Collections on the procurement of new collections and development of programs to reach new audiences;
  • Work with Director of Museum Collections on the development of public exhibits and development of exclusive member and donor programs;
  • Work with the Senior Director on all financial matters and volunteer and intern activities;
  • Collaborate with the Chief Operating Officer of Philanthropic Activities of the TAWANI Foundation and the Pritzker Military Foundation to establish and maintain partnerships with local and national organizations;
  • Develop programs that link the PMML (Chicago) with the PMAC (Somers, WI) for cross-promotion and engagement.

BOARD OF DIRECTORS & EXTERNAL RELATIONS:

  • Organize and Participate in meetings of the Board of Directors as an ex officio member;
  • In cooperation with the Board of Directors, lead the strategic development process to achieve agreed upon long term goals;
  • Establish and maintain relationships with VIP members and donors in order to be a conduit for their message;
  • Work with MarCom team to effectively advance the visibility, mission and message of the PMML;
  • Establish and maintain partnerships with local and national universities, identifying the PMML as a resource to the academic community;
  • Act as spokesperson for the PMML;
  • Understand and execute on the terms of complex business relationships and contracts;
  • Work with Founder & Chair to grow a board of directors with local, regional and national reach;
  • Serve as a board member of the Pritzker Military Foundation;
  • Serve as the administrative head and as an ex-officio member of the PMML Literature Award Screening Committee and PMML Citizen Soldier Award Committee.

OPERATIONAL:

  • Create and implement a strategic plan with specific, measurable, outcomes;
  • Supervision and professional development of 5 direct reports and a staff of more than 22 full-time, part-time, interns and volunteers
  • Work with TAWANI CFO and COO of Philanthropic Activities to develop and execute annual budget;
  • Advise and inform the COO of Philanthropic Activities on all issues related to administrative matters of the PMML;
  • Attend and support PMML regularly scheduled and special events, including but not limited to evening events;
  • Develop and deliver reports relevant to PMML operations at both Chicago and Somers campuses as directed/requested by the Board of Directors;
  • Coordinate with TAWANI Enterprises, TAWANI Foundation, Pritzker Military Foundation and other organizational counterparts to support operations and activities;
  • Special projects or assignments as requested by the Board of Directors
  • Direct the work of key PMML contractors including individuals hired toward PMML book production, PR, Fundraising, special project work.
  • Work with other Tawani Enterprises contractors as required toward special projects and regular operations
